well dress industry
Stage: Nascent
Key opportunity: Implement AI-powered demand forecasting and inventory optimization to reduce stockouts and overproduction across seasonal uniform lines.
Top use cases
- AI Demand Forecasting — Leverage historical sales and external data to predict uniform demand, reducing overstock by 20%.
- Defect Detection via Computer Vision — Deploy cameras on production lines to catch fabric flaws and stitching errors in real-time, cutting returns.
- Predictive Maintenance for Machinery — Use IoT sensors to predict sewing machine failures, scheduling maintenance during off-peak to avoid downtime.
